LA Observed picks up on the news that the Boyle Heights blogger at Spanglish Gringo was told by the Los Angeles Times that he can no longer receive the paper at home because the "delivery person complained of being chased by gangs in this neighborhood..." But as LA Observed points out, the Wall Street Journal continues to get to the same blogger's house just fine. [LA Observed]
